Elizabeth is a seasoned legal executive with over three decades of experience advising private and public companies on a broad range of complex legal, regulatory, and business matters. Elizabeth brings a practical, business-oriented approach to legal strategy, contracts, litigation and compliance.
Her previous roles include serving as General Counsel and Corporate Secretary for Floworks International LLC, where she led global legal operations across the U.S., Canada, China, and Europe, managing M&A transactions, intellectual property, regulatory compliance, and corporate governance. She has also held leadership roles at Targa Resources Corp., SESCO Cement Corp. and the City of Houston Legal Department, where she directed transformative organizational change.
Elizabeth’s experience spans trial litigation, mergers and acquisitions, labor and employment, ESG compliance, and corporate ethics.
Elizabeth is an active leader in the legal and civic community, serving on the boards of the Coastal Plains Chapter of the American Red Cross and Medical Bridges of Houston, and remains a dedicated advisor to the Hispanic Bar Association of Houston.
Elizabeth is a Certified Corporate Compliance and Ethics Professional and holds both a J.D. and an LL.M. in Energy, Environment & Natural Resources from the University of Houston. Elizabeth is licensed to practice law in Texas.
